This may already be there, and I haven't found it but...

Ok, so you're side scanning an area trying to find brush. You already marked quite a few piles in the area on previous trips. Wouldn't it be great if while on your full SI screen that a dot/marker would show up on a waypoint that you've already marked? I'm talking as the sonar scrolls over a pile you've marked, it shows that marking on the actual live sonar scroll. Of course you should be able to hide/show these so you can see if there are fish on them if you want.

Also, I think it would be great if on the chart that the little boat symbol would show the scan width that you are set on with your si so you can see if you should be picking up waypoints on your sonar that you are passing on your chart. So, if you have your SI set to 60ft on each side, there would be a line going out 60' on each side of the little boat symbol. Does that make sense?
